Alomone Labs is pleased to offer a highly specific antibody directed against an epitope of human TRPV5.Anti-TRPV5 Antibody(#ACC-035) can be used in western blot, immunocytochemistry and immunohistochemistry applications. It has been designed to recognize TRPV5 from human, mouse and rat samples. Anti-TRPV5 Antibody –(Carrier Free) (#ACC-035-CF). This ready-to-use, carrier-free formulation is free of BSA and sodium azide, making it ideal for conjugation, sensitive downstream applications and specialized assay development. The size of this version is0.2 mlat a concentration of1 mg/ml, and It has been designed to recognize TRPV5 from human, mouse and rat samples. Product Specifications
Specifications
NameAnti-TRPV5 Antibody
Cat. No.ACC-035
Accession NumberQ8NDW5
Gene ID (Entrez)56302
HostRabbit
RRIDAB_2039793
IsotypeRabbit IgG.
ReactivityHuman,Mouse,Rat
ApplicationICC, IF, IHC, WB
ClonalityPolyclonal
ImmunogenPeptide (C)GLNLSEGDGEEVYHF, corresponding to amino acid residues 715-729 of human TRPV5 (Accession Q9NQA5 ). Intracellular, C-terminus.
Appearance/FormLyophilized_Powder
Reconstitution0.2 ml double distilled water (DDW).
StorageThe antibody ships as a lyophilized powder at room temperature. Upon arrival, it should be stored at -20°C.
